Viaduct in Rogów – working day and night

The facility is constructed at a railway line characterized by largest intensification of traffic in Poland. Works are conducted during the day and during night-time breaks in train traffic. At the end of June, main stages of building the viaduct falsework were completed at the end of June. At the same time, works in the road part are being performed.

Trakcja PRKiI S.A. is building a road viaduct in Rogów town at the intersection of the Warsaw – Łódź line and national road no. 72. The first stage of the investment was building a bypassing road with the length of 870 meters along with a temporary railway crossing, at the rail level, and a partial reconstruction of 809 meters of the national road. Construction works at the viaduct were commenced at the break of February and March this year. The specificity of the facility and geological conditions required setting a viaduct on 128 poles with the diameter of 1 meter, placed in the ground at the depth of 9.5 m. The bearing part consists of 14 pre-stressed concrete beams with the length of 17.7 m and weighing 13.5 tons each. These elements were constructed during two night-time breaks in train traffic in mid June. Total length of the viaduct is 48 m, width - 13.7 m, spread of arches - 17,5 m, width - 13.76 m, vertical clearance 6.3 m, horizontal clearance 16.4 m. These dimensions allow laying down a road with two lanes with the width of 3.50 meter each, and two footpaths with the width of 1.50 meter. The scope of works also provides for building 630 meters of a footpath, two bus bays, and a municipal road with the width of 480 meters. The facility will be equipped with a road dewatering system consisting of dewatering ditches and separators of oil substances.
